What does Shadowbox Cabaret do?

Shadowbox Cabaret, also known as Shadowbox Live, is a full-time resident theatre ensemble founded in Columbus, Ohio, in 1988. The company produces original, genre-shifting work featuring professionally trained metaperformers and presents shows in a cabaret-style format where performers also serve as staff.

About Shadowbox Cabaret

Founded in Columbus, Ohio in 1988, Shadowbox Live is the nation's largest full-time resident theatre ensemble, featuring professionally trained metaperformers. Shadowbox Live produces a diverse body of bold, genre-shifting original work that seeks to challenge audiences through the shared joy of live performing art.
